Come and try with the Friends of Warriparinga! Learn what it means to be a conservation volunteer working along Warripari (Sturt River) in Bedford Park and find out about some of our amazing local biodiversity.
A come and try event is a great way for people to learn about what conservation activities volunteers are undertaking locally, and to see if it's something they'd like to become involved in. This mini working bee will be followed by a nature tour of the site with Revegetation Advisor Paul Green.
Paul writes, “We will marvel at how much environmental restoration can be achieved by a small group of dedicated volunteers working consistently for over 30 years. We will undertake a multi-sensory exploration of the revegetation. We will become acquainted with the animals which have re-colonised the revegetation. And finally, we will see some of the challenges encountered during revegetation programs.”
